Prime Vacant Land in Iwakuni, Yamaguchi
This vacant plot of land, located in the Shozoku-cho 1-chome district of Iwakuni City, Yamaguchi Prefecture, presents an excellent opportunity for residential development. The property is a flat, cleared site with a total land area of 175.2 square meters (approximately 52.99 tsubo). It is situated on a corner lot within a Low-Rise Residential Zone, offering favorable building conditions with an 80% building coverage ratio and a 200% floor area ratio. The site fronts a public road over 6 meters wide to the southeast, with a frontage of 9 meters, and requires no set-back. The land is designated as residential within a City Planning Area (Urbanization Promotion Area) and is zoned as a Quasi-Residential District.
